Reviewer : Indefatigable Rating : 3
Review : Not a bad episode. Some might see this episode as the one where the Doctor comes to life. In my opinion, it is just the culmination of a long transition he has been going through ever since "Parallax". Still, this was quite critical in the development of the character. The obvious 'beauty comes from within' message was hard to miss and fair enough, but that was really overshadowed by the character development side of the story. What's going on with Paris as well? Should they really have characters who act in such an irresponsible way? Either they're setting something up or the writers have gone over the top again.
